SUBSCRIBE NOW!Speaking on his YouTube channel, Ashwin said Billings comes from immense wealth but has remained down-to-earth despite his privileged background.“Sam Billings is not a normal guy. He owns almost half of Kent. We keep cooks and maids in our houses, but in those countries, to have a chef is a huge deal. His house has separate people for housekeeping, laundry, etc. He comes from that background, but a really, really simple guy,” Ashwin remarked.Billings, who represented Delhi Capitals, CSK, and Kolkata Knight Riders in the IPL, never quite lived up to his potential in the tournament. Across 30 matches, he managed just 503 runs at an average below 20 and a strike rate under 130.Reflecting on Billings’ IPL struggles, Ashwin said: “A player like Sam Billings is a hit in other formats; he has even performed very well in the ILT20. I remember he performed well for CSK for a few games but couldn’t sustain that performance. So, he was out of the team.”Ashwin further highlighted the intense pressure overseas players face in the IPL. “There is a lot of pressure on these foreign players. Because if four foreign players are allowed in a team, you will have to perform. If you don’t perform in two to three games, you will be out of the team,” he added.
